Spoon music biography continued...
Spoon — named for a song by the German experimental band Can — in 1993 along with drummer Jim Eno, guitarist Greg Wilson and bassist Andy McGuire. The following year, the band released a seven-inch EP, Nafarious, on the small indie label Fluffer Records. Spoon caught the attention of the larger indie label Matador Records, on which the band released its first full-length disc, Telephono, in 1996. Hailed by critics, the effort garnered the band major label attention and they soon signed with Elektra, but after their major label debut, A Series of Sneaks, did not sell fast enough, they were subsequently dropped. Daniel and Eno continued to write songs, however, and in 2001 the band signed with North Carolina indie label Merge Records. Spoon's first Merge album, Girls Can Tell, reached number 46 on the charts and was named one of the Top Independent Albums in 2001. Its follow-up, Kill the Moonlight, peaked at number 23 on the charts and was also named to the Top Independent Album list of 2002. Both LPs outsold the band's previous two discs and when one of Moonlight's tracks, "The Way We Get By," appeared in the popular teen TV show The O.C., Spoon hit the big time.
Their next album, Gimme Fiction, was released in May 2005, and debuted at number 44 on the Billboard 200, selling more than 160,000 copies. Following this effort, Daniel collaborated with Brian Reitzell to compose and arrange the soundtrack for the 2006 film Stranger than Fiction, which gave Spoon even broader exposure. This was followed by 2007's Ga Ga Ga Ga Ga, which debuted at number 10 on the Billboard 200. With this success, Spoon garnered even more mainstream attention, with their tracks featured on several prime time television programs. They've also performed on late night television, finally reveling in the mainstream attention and respect they worked so hard to achieve.
